Chapters 10 & 11 (pages 171-197 and endnotes) Summary

Maka Khan and other Khalsa soldiers hold Flashman captive inside the house. Maka Khan tells Flashman that the Khalsa is already crossing the Sutlej River, and war is about to begin. He also tells Flashman that that for some time they have known how Flashman sent his coded messages. As for breaking the code, Flashman is reminded that cryptography is an Indian invention. In addition to knowing Flashman's purpose and the code, they know Jassa's true identity.

Maka Khan tells Flashman that he wants to know all that Flashman knows regarding the Khalsa military capabilities and strategies, or he plans to have Flashman taken to the cellar and tortured. Flashman, nearly in hysterics, begins telling him that he does not know much but that he will tell everything.
